Senate GOP Cranks Up the Heat: New Sanctions Against Russia on the Table
The Senate GOP is demanding stronger sanctions against Russia as tensions escalate over Ukraine. Key points include:
- Senate Republicans urge new sanctions amidst ongoing conflict.
- Trump's frustration with Putin intensifies without a peace deal in sight.
- Former Russian leaders raise alarming threats of World War III.
- The political landscape shifts with Trump's potential sanctions on Russia.
